  3. Are you ready for this? 1999 Daewoo Leganza SE Now, I know what you're thinking (what a POS). But, with a Daewoo, there's more than meets the eye to them. After the Asian financial collapse of 2000, the company finally agreed to be bought by General Motors in 2002. (The part of them that they didn't already own.) This was after heavy bidding by DaimlerChrysler, Ford, Toyota and several other companies. The reasons for Daewoo's demise: 1. Corrupt CEO pulling an Enron type of crime and felling the country. The South Korean authorities are still looking for him. 2. The horrible Asian economy at the time. 3. Since the early 70's, Daewoo has been sort of a "captive import" company to General Motors, due to a joint venture that was started in 1973. You could have driven a Daewoo and not even known it! Daewoo has made cars for several other companies, too! here are some examples: 1989-1993 Pontiac Lemans and GSE, and Opel Kadett = Daewoo Nexia and Daewoo Racer 2004-present Suzuki Verona = Daewoo Magnus (formerly Leganza) 2004-present Suzuki Forenza = Daewoo Nubira 2004- present Suzuki Reno (wagon) = Daewoo Nubira (wagon) 2004-present Chvrolet Aveo = Daewoo Kalos There are others, but here's a general list of companies that Daewoo has built cars for: Buick, Chevrolet, Pontiac, Opel, Vauxhall, Holden(Australian GM), FSO, SEAT, ZAZ... In a typical Daewoo, there are more GM components than anything GM makes in the United States. In my Leganza, here's a rundown: Engine: Holden (GM Australia) an an interpretation of a Mazda design tha twas licensed to Holden), Transmission: Toyota Electric: GM Chassis: GM, tuned by Lotus (another GM division). Daewoo is now known as GMDAT (General Motors/Daewoo Automotive Technology) and is owned jointly by Holden (58%), Suzuki (30%), and SIAC (General Motors China) (12%).
